Chapter 10.29 Contractors and Workers

Article I. Blasting

Section 10.29.010 License and Permit
  1. A. No person may work as a blaster or operate as a contractor using explosives or blasting agents without a current license issued by the city engineer, bond and insurance as provided in SMC 17G.010.210.
  1. No person may conduct blasting operations without a blasting permit as provided in SMC 17G.010.210(A).
  1. The blasting license and permit are in the nature of a class IIE license under chapter 4.04 SMC.
  1. Additionally, IFC section 105.6.15 requires a permit from the fire official to:
    1. manufacture, possess, store, sell, use or dispose of explosives or blasting agents;
    1. operate a terminal for handling explosives or blasting agents, and to deliver or receive same at a terminal during the hours of darkness; or
    1. transport explosives or blasting agents or transport blasting caps on the same vehicle with explosives.
